Python - 문제 미리보기

문제 1854

medium
Python의 데이터 타입 분류에서 올바르지 않은 것은?
A. list, tuple, range → Sequence Types
B. int, float, complex → Numeric Types
C. set, frozenset → Set Types
D. str, bytes → Numeric Types

정답: D



⦁ Python 데이터 타입의 올바른 분류:

Text Type (텍스트 타입):
⦁ `str`: 문자열

Numeric Types (숫자 타입):
⦁ `int`: 정수
⦁ `float`: 실수
⦁ `complex`: 복소수

Sequence Types (시퀀스 타입):
⦁ `list`: 리스트 (가변)
⦁ `tuple`: 튜플 (불변)
⦁ `range`: 범위

Mapping Type (매핑 타입):
⦁ `dict`: 딕셔너리

Set Types (집합 타입):
⦁ `set`: 집합 (가변)
⦁ `frozenset`: 집합 (불변)

Boolean Type (불린 타입):
⦁ `bool`: 불린

Binary Types (바이너리 타입):
⦁ `bytes`: 바이트 (불변)
⦁ `bytearray`: 바이트 배열 (가변)
⦁ `memoryview`: 메모리 뷰

⦁ 4번이 틀린 이유:
⦁ `str`은 Text Type에 속함
⦁ `bytes`는 Binary Type에 속함
⦁ 둘 다 Numeric Types가 아님

💡 학습 팁

이 문제를 포함한 Python 과목의 모든 문제를 순차적으로 풀어보세요. 진행상황이 자동으로 저장되어 언제든지 이어서 학습할 수 있습니다.